func TestMiddlewareDigestAuthValid(t *testing.T) {
|
|
cfg := AuthConfig{
|
|
Enabled: true,
|
|
Username: "testuser",
|
|
Password: "testpass",
|
|
Realm: "Test Realm",
|
|
NonceExpiry: 5 * time.Minute,
|
|
}
|
|
da := NewDigestAuth(cfg)
|
|
defer da.Stop()
|
|
|
|
router := gin.New()
|
|
router.Use(da.Middleware())
|
|
router.GET("/test", func(c *gin.Context) {
|
|
c.String(http.StatusOK, "success")
|
|
})
|
|
|
|
// First request to get nonce
|
|
req := httptest.NewRequest("GET", "/test", nil)
|
|
w := httptest.NewRecorder()
|
|
router.ServeHTTP(w, req)
|
|
|
|
if w.Code != http.StatusUnauthorized {
|
|
t.Fatalf("expected 401 to get nonce, got %d", w.Code)
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
wwwAuth := w.Header().Get("WWW-Authenticate")
|
|
params := parseDigestParams(wwwAuth[7:]) // Skip "Digest "
|
|
nonce := params["nonce"]
|
|
|
|
if nonce == "" {
|
|
t.Fatal("nonce not found in challenge")
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Build digest auth response
|
|
uri := "/test"
|
|
nc := "00000001"
|
|
cnonce := "abc123"
|
|
qop := "auth"
|
|
|
|
ha1 := md5Hash(fmt.Sprintf("%s:%s:%s", cfg.Username, cfg.Realm, cfg.Password))
|
|
ha2 := md5Hash(fmt.Sprintf("GET:%s", uri))
|
|
response := md5Hash(fmt.Sprintf("%s:%s:%s:%s:%s:%s", ha1, nonce, nc, cnonce, qop, ha2))
|
|
|
|
authHeader := fmt.Sprintf(
|
|
`Digest username="%s", realm="%s", nonce="%s", uri="%s", qop=%s, nc=%s, cnonce="%s", response="%s"`,
|
|
cfg.Username, cfg.Realm, nonce, uri, qop, nc, cnonce, response,
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
// Second request with digest auth
|
|
req2 := httptest.NewRequest("GET", "/test", nil)
|
|
req2.Header.Set("Authorization", authHeader)
|
|
w2 := httptest.NewRecorder()
|
|
router.ServeHTTP(w2, req2)
|
|
|
|
if w2.Code != http.StatusOK {
|
|
t.Errorf("expected status 200, got %d; body: %s", w2.Code, w2.Body.String())
|
|
}
|
|
}
